Australia - Re-Import of Radio Navigational Aid Apparatus

Since 2014, Australia Re-Import of Radio Navigational Aid Apparatus increased 4.2% year on year. With $443,964.83 in 2019, the country was ranked number 6 among other countries in Re-Import of Radio Navigational Aid Apparatus. Australia is overtaken by South Africa, which was number 5 at $464,184.05 and is followed by Italy with $176,016.3. United Kingdom topped the ranking with $13,328,910.22 in 2019, that is -9.3% compared to 2018. China, Canada and France resp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Thailand witnessed the best average annual growth at +108.6% per year, while Namibia witnessed the worst performance at -76.1% per year.
